Gill's Notes on the Bible
And at the ninth hour Jesus cried with a loud voice,....
:-;
saying, Eloi, Eloi, lama sabachthani? in Matthew it is, "Eli, Eli", Both "Eli" and "Eloi", are Hebrew words, and signify the same; and are both used in Psalms 22:1, from whence the whole is taken:
which is, being interpreted, my God, my God, why hast thou forsaken me? Psalms 22:1- :.
